I think most people start playing poker with the hope of winning a big prize in a tournament. However, along the way, many of us end up falling in love with the game itself.

Even when I play very low buy-in tournaments or freerolls, as the tournament progresses and stacks get shorter, the emotions become intense. Being close to the top spots, every decision feels important, and that mix of nerves and excitement is what makes poker such a rewarding game to play.
